The Role of a Professional Pet Groomer
A professional pet groomer is responsible for far more than basic cleaning. Grooming sessions are structured to support hygiene, coat condition, and overall comfort. Each visit allows the groomer to assess coat health, skin condition, and physical changes that may need attention.
Regular professional grooming helps prevent common issues such as matting, excessive shedding, overgrown nails, and skin irritation. These problems, when left unmanaged, can lead to infections, discomfort, and behavioral stress in pets. Grooming provides a controlled environment where these risks are addressed safely.
Another important role of a groomer is observation. Groomers often notice early signs of ear infections, lumps, hot spots, or coat abnormalities. Early awareness allows pet owners to seek veterinary support before small concerns become serious issues.
A structured grooming routine also helps pets become accustomed to handling. Over time, this reduces anxiety, improves cooperation, and creates a more positive experience during grooming and veterinary visits alike.
Why Regular Grooming Supports Long Term Health
Grooming plays a critical role in maintaining a pet’s overall health. Brushing removes loose fur, dirt, and dander that can irritate skin or contribute to allergies. Bathing clears bacteria and debris that accumulate from daily activity. Together, these services protect the skin barrier and coat condition.
Routine nail trimming prevents painful splitting and posture problems. Overgrown nails can alter how a dog walks, placing stress on joints and increasing the risk of injury. Ear cleaning reduces moisture buildup, which helps lower the chance of painful infections.
Grooming also promotes circulation. Brushing stimulates the skin and distributes natural oils across the coat. This keeps fur healthier, shinier, and less prone to breakage.
Consistent care allows pets to stay comfortable year-round. Seasonal coat changes, humidity, and outdoor exposure all impact grooming needs. Professional attention ensures adjustments are made at the right time to support comfort and cleanliness.
Understanding Coat Types and Grooming Needs
Every pet has unique grooming requirements based on coat type, breed, and activity level. Short-coated pets benefit from routine brushing and bathing to manage shedding and skin oils. Long-coated pets require more frequent grooming to prevent matting and tangles.
Curly and double-coated breeds need specialized care to manage undercoat buildup and seasonal shedding. Without proper maintenance, these coats trap moisture and debris, increasing the risk of hot spots and irritation.
Professional groomers tailor services to these coat characteristics. Tools, bathing products, and drying methods are selected to support coat health rather than damage it. Using improper techniques can weaken fur, irritate skin, or cause uneven regrowth.
Customized grooming routines also factor in lifestyle. Pets that swim, hike, or spend extended time outdoors often require more frequent care. A structured grooming approach ensures pets stay clean, manageable, and protected regardless of daily activity.
The Importance of Safe Bathing and Drying
Bathing is a foundational part of professional grooming. It removes allergens, dirt, and odor while refreshing the coat. However, safe bathing requires more than soap and water. Temperature control, proper shampoo selection, and thorough rinsing are essential.
Professional-grade grooming products are formulated to match a pet’s skin pH. This prevents dryness, irritation, and allergic reactions. Proper rinsing ensures no residue remains that could cause itching or flaking.
Drying is equally important. Damp undercoats can trap moisture and lead to fungal or bacterial growth. Controlled drying methods remove moisture efficiently while protecting skin and coat structure.
Safe bathing routines maintain coat softness, manage odor, and reduce shedding. Over time, this contributes to healthier skin, easier maintenance between visits, and a noticeably cleaner pet.
Nail Trimming and Paw Care Essentials
Nail care is often overlooked but plays a major role in pet comfort. Long nails place unnatural pressure on joints, toes, and paw pads. This can cause pain, posture changes, and mobility issues over time.
Professional nail trimming ensures nails are kept at a proper length while avoiding sensitive quicks. Groomers are trained to recognize nail structure and work safely across different breeds and sizes.
Paw care also includes inspection of pads and between-toe areas. Groomers check for cracks, debris, matting, or irritation that could interfere with movement or cause discomfort.
Regular attention keeps paws healthy, supports balanced movement, and reduces the risk of injury. Over time, consistent nail and paw care improves a pet’s posture, comfort, and overall confidence during activity.
Managing Shedding and Skin Health
Shedding is natural, but unmanaged shedding can overwhelm a home and indicate coat imbalance. Professional grooming helps regulate shedding cycles through proper brushing, bathing, and coat treatments.
Deshedding techniques remove loose undercoat before it falls throughout the home. This improves airflow to the skin, reduces irritation, and helps coats regrow evenly.
Healthy skin depends on balanced moisture levels and cleanliness. Grooming removes buildup while supporting oil distribution across the coat. This keeps fur resilient and reduces dryness or flaking.
Skin health is directly tied to grooming consistency. Pets that follow structured grooming schedules experience fewer tangles, less itching, and improved coat texture. Over time, this leads to easier home maintenance and greater overall comfort.
Reducing Stress Through Consistent Grooming
Pets respond best to routines. Consistent grooming schedules help reduce anxiety by creating familiarity. Over time, pets learn what to expect, which lowers fear and resistance.
Professional groomers work in controlled environments designed to support calm handling. Gentle techniques, structured processes, and attention to behavior cues help maintain positive experiences.
When grooming is irregular, pets are more likely to experience matting, nail overgrowth, and coat discomfort. These issues can make sessions longer and more stressful. Regular care prevents these complications from developing.
A calm grooming routine strengthens trust between pets and caregivers. It supports emotional well-being while maintaining physical health. Over time, grooming becomes a predictable, manageable part of a pet’s lifestyle.
How Grooming Supports Early Health Detection
One of the most valuable benefits of grooming is early detection. Groomers routinely examine skin, ears, paws, and coats. This consistent observation allows changes to be noticed quickly.
Small lumps, sore spots, ear redness, or coat thinning are often detected during grooming sessions. Early awareness gives pet owners the opportunity to seek veterinary advice promptly.
Grooming also reveals behavioral changes. Increased sensitivity, discomfort, or unusual reactions can signal underlying concerns. These insights help guide further care decisions.
By combining hygiene and observation, grooming supports preventative wellness. This proactive approach helps extend quality of life and ensures pets receive attention before problems escalate.
